Euornithes

Euornithes \Eu`or*ni"thes\, n. pl. [NL., fr., Gr. e'y^ well + ?, ? a bird.] (Zo["o]l.) The division of Aves which includes all the typical birds, or all living birds except the penguins and birds of ostrichlike form.

Euornithes

Euornithes (meaning "true birds" in Greek) is a natural group which includes the most recent common ancestor of all avialans closer to modern birds than to Sinornis.
